A Guitar Built Around Feel
At first glance, the Cobra Burst finish grabs attention — but the deeper appeal is in the construction. A three-ply maple/poplar/maple body with figured maple outer layers keeps things articulate and resonant, while the mahogany neck and bound ebony fretboard add richness and snap under the fingers. The 50s Rounded Medium C profile lands in that sweet spot between vintage comfort and modern playability.
This is very much a player’s instrument. The balance feels right on a strap, the neck fills the hand without slowing you down, and the semi-hollow construction gives notes an openness that solidbodies can’t fake.
Classic 355 Styling, No Compromises
The ES-355 has always represented the upscale side of the ES lineage, and Gibson didn’t cut corners here. Multi-ply binding, mother-of-pearl block inlays, and the Custom split-diamond headstock make this instantly recognizable on stage.
The VOS nickel hardware, ABR-1 no-wire bridge, and Bigsby B7 vibrato complete the package with the kind of visual sophistication that makes the guitar look as good under stage lights as it does in a studio rack.

Tone: Wide Open and Dynamic
The electronics are where this model separates itself from many modern signature guitars. Unpotted Custombuckers with Alnico 3 magnets give the guitar a dynamic response that rewards touch — soft playing stays articulate, while digging in brings out the growl and harmonic bloom players chase in vintage instruments.
CTS audio taper pots, paper-in-oil capacitors, and a mono Varitone circuit expand the tonal range beyond standard semi-hollow territory. You can move from smoky jazz textures to aggressive blues-rock leads without fighting the instrument.
This isn’t a guitar that forces you into one sound. It adapts to the player.
Limited for a Reason
Only 100 of these guitars are being handcrafted in Nashville, which puts this squarely into collector-grade territory while still being absolutely road-worthy. Each one ships in a Gibson Custom hardshell case featuring Gary Clark Jr. graphics.
